The Minister of Foreign Affairs of Azerbaijan, Jeyhun Bayramov, received the representative of the UN High Commissioner for Refugees in Azerbaijan, Bik Lum.
Axar.az was informed about this by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
At the meeting, issues arising from cooperation with the UN High Commissioner for Refugees, as well as the current situation in the region, were exchanged.
J. Bayramov noted the importance of the joint projects implemented with UNHCR in the direction of eliminating the humanitarian consequences of the past Armenia-Azerbaijan conflict, improving the living conditions of our citizens who became refugees and IDPs as a result of Armenia's aggression against Azerbaijan.
It was pointed out that the "Great Return" program aimed at ensuring the dignified return of our citizens to the territories freed from occupation is one of the main priorities for our country, and the other party was informed about the work done in this field.
The minister also informed the other party about the preparations for the 29th session of the Conference of the Parties to the UN Framework Convention on Climate Change (COP29), and the possibilities of cooperation within the framework of COP29 were reviewed.
It was noted by the UN representative that numerous projects have been implemented for Azerbaijani IDPs over the past 30 years, and that they are ready to be supported by the organization they represent in the field of humanitarian demining in cooperation with ANAMA.
Other issues of mutual interest were also discussed during the meeting.
